Details and patient eligibility

About

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the effects of multiple doses of strong cytochrome P450 (CYP) 3A4 inhibitor itraconazole and strong CYP3A4 inducer rifampin on the single dose pharmacokinetics (PK) of lazertinib in healthy adult participants.

Inclusion criteria

  • A woman must not be of childbearing potential and must have a negative serum beta-human chorionic gonadotropin (Beta HCG) pregnancy test at screening
  • Hormone replacement therapy (if applicable) must have been discontinued at least 28 days prior to the first dose of study drug (Cohort 2 only)
  • Participants must have a body mass index (BMI) between 18.0 and 32.0 kilogram per meter square (kg/m^2, inclusive (BMI = weight/height^2), and body weight not less than 50 kg at screening
  • Participants must be healthy based on physical examination, medical history, and vital signs (pulse and body temperature), performed at screening
  • Male participants must agree to use an adequate contraception method

Exclusion criteria

  • History of or current clinically significant medical illness that the investigator considers should exclude the participant or that could interfere with the interpretation of the study results
  • History of infection suspected or confirmed to be related to Co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) within 4 weeks before intake of study drug
  • Participant has known allergies, hypersensitivity, or intolerance to lazertinib or its excipients or to itraconazole and rifampin
  • Participant has contraindications to the use itraconazole and rifampin per local prescribing information
  • Use of any cytochrome P450 (CYP) 3A4 inhibitors or inducers (other than per-protocol itraconazole/rifampin administration) within 4 weeks before the first dose of the study drug is scheduled until completion of the study

32 participants in 2 patient groups

Cohort 1: Lazertinib plus Itraconazole
Experimental group
Description:
Participants will receive a single oral dose of lazertinib tablets in Treatment Period 1 followed by itraconazole capsules orally along with a single oral dose of lazertinib tablet in Treatment Period 2.
Treatment:
Drug: Lazertinib
Drug: Itraconazole
Cohort 2: Lazertinib plus Rifampin
Experimental group
Description:
Participants will receive a single oral dose of lazertinib tablets in Treatment Period 1 followed by rifampin capsules orally along with a single oral dose of lazertinib tablet in Treatment Period 2.
